Output f622ab8c21a374e37c5341421302682d056a0a46c51a93899b975642d1803807:6

value
513446280
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ef4f4deb2c172a70b275294ea6257900e430e12f OP_EQUAL
address
MViWjSaggNKBztwGoRWQJrAJUsUqb25wsc
transaction
f622ab8c21a374e37c5341421302682d056a0a46c51a93899b975642d1803807
spent
true